Indian cuisine is known for its bold flavors and aromatic spices. If you’re looking to step up your game in the kitchen, there are plenty of cooking ideas that can help you bring the taste of India to your table.

One of the easiest ways to incorporate Indian flavors into your cooking is by using spice blends. Garam masala, curry powder, and turmeric are just a few examples of the many spice blends that are used in Indian cuisine. Use them to season meat, vegetables, or even roasted nuts or popcorn.

Another staple of Indian cuisine is yogurt-based marinates and sauces. Mix together plain yogurt, lemon juice, and your favorite spices for a quick and easy marinade for chicken or fish. Or, try making raita, a cooling yogurt sauce that pairs perfectly with spicy dishes.

If you’re looking for vegetarian options, there are plenty of Indian dishes that can be made without meat. Try making chana masala, a hearty chickpea stew with tomatoes and spices, or aloo gobi, a flavorful dish made with potatoes and cauliflower. Both dishes can be served with rice or naan bread.

For those who are looking for a challenge, try making biryani, a fragrant rice dish that’s made with layers of rice, meat, and vegetables. Or, make your own tikka masala, a spicy tomato-based sauce that’s traditionally served with chicken.

No matter what kind of cooking idea you choose to explore, remember that Indian cuisine is all about bold flavor and experimentation. Don’t be afraid to try something new and make each dish your own!
